2. 打开CMake gui 设置如图,opencvbuild455是一个 空/不存在 文件夹—— 用于保存安装opencv的路径。 3. 分别Search 下属内容,勾选和设置路径 这里设置为contrib下的modules的路径 这里勾选(如果需要nonfree的功能) 这里是帮助集成到一个lib中,强烈建议 我这里没有带上cuda, 如果你也没有就取消勾选不
https://gitee.com/kingstoneai/opencv_contrib.git (另外还有解决 网络问题,提前下载好的 [opencv/.cache]压缩包) 2、使用 CMake 生成 OpenCV 解决方案 操作步骤 1、使用 CMake (gui) 打开 opencv\CMakeLists.txt,置构建输出的目录 2、点击 Configure 开始配置,指定项目生成器目标为 “Visual Studio 14 2015...
如图所示,勾选OPENCV_ENABLE_NONFREE,选择OPENCV_FORCE3RDPARTY_BUILD的路径(即opencv_contrib-4.1.1/modules) 再次configure至红色消失 点击generate生成文件,出现generate done即可(不要关闭CMake) 三、编译OpenCV.sln工程 1.重新生成 CMake编译后可以直接点击open project打开OpenCV.sln文件,或者打开opencv_build文件找...
Set OPENCV_ENABLE_NONFREE CMake option and rebuild the library in function 'cv::xfeatures2d::SIFT::c 那么要么是因为你安装的是opencv-python,或者没有安装正确opencv-contrib-python的版本。 如果是这样,你可以先卸载本地的cv2,方法为(要看你当时安装的是opencv-python还是opencv-contrib-python): pip unin...
⑥将压缩包(opencv_contrib-3.4.7)解压到指定路径下,建议和opencv解压缩后的文件放在同一个文件夹中。 点开文件夹的样子如下,其中modules中存放着opencv中的扩展模块: 到此为止,我们的opencv及其扩展模块就安装完成了。 3、安装编译工具CMake ①进CMake的官方网址下载即可。戳这里 ...
cmake下载安装版本或者直接使用的版本都可以。 下载完opencv源码和超集扩展包得到两个压缩包文件 将其解压得到opencv_contrib-4.10.0和opencv-4.10.0文件夹,将opencv_contrib-4.10.0放进opencv-4.10.0文件夹当中,如下: 之后建立新的文件夹用于存放cmake编译之后的文件,如下: ...
https://github.com/opencv/opencvhttps://github.com/opencv/opencv_contrib 下载后解压到指定目录: 在opencv-4.8.0文件夹下新建一个build文件夹用于保存编译文件: 自己安装CUDA相关依赖项,包括CUDA和CUDNN: 【3】CMake配置选项设置 CMake配置选项设置需要注意的地方如下: ...
opencv-contrib网址:https:///opencv/opencv_contrib/releases CMake网址:https://cmake.org/download/ 两者版本一定要相同!!! 2. 下载完成后,打开CMake(最好用比较新版本的CMake),点击“Browse Source...”,找到opencv解压后的sources文件夹。 点击“Browse Build...”,可以在opencv文件夹下新建一个文件夹,用...
2) Open cmake-gui. Or if you are fairly familiar with camke cmdlines, skip this step. 3) Choose compiler you want to use, MinGW can be used if you would like to compile your projects in vscode. If you are using Microsoft visual studio, don't bother to compile opencv from so...